Migration Patterns and Behavior of Bald Eagles

Bald eagles exhibit a range of migratory behaviors that are largely influenced by geographic location, climate, and food availability. Unlike some bird species that undertake long, consistent migrations, bald eagle migration is more variable and often partial, meaning only a portion of the population migrates depending on regional conditions.

In northern regions such as Alaska and Canada, bald eagles tend to migrate southward during the harsh winter months. This movement is primarily driven by the freezing of water bodies, which limits access to their primary food source—fish. Conversely, populations in more temperate or southern areas may remain resident year-round if food is plentiful and water bodies do not freeze.

Migration distances can vary significantly. Some eagles travel hundreds of miles to reach milder climates, while others move shorter distances locally or remain resident. Juvenile bald eagles are more likely to migrate longer distances than adults, often dispersing widely before returning to breeding territories.

Key factors influencing bald eagle migration include:

  • Food Availability: Frozen lakes and rivers restrict fishing opportunities, prompting migration.
  • Temperature: Severe cold drives eagles southward.
  • Age: Younger birds tend to migrate farther.
  • Breeding Season: Eagles return to breeding grounds in spring.

Seasonal Movements and Habitat Preferences

During migration, bald eagles select habitats that provide ample food and safety for resting. These habitats often include large bodies of water such as lakes, rivers, and coastal areas where fish congregate. Open landscapes with tall trees or cliffs are preferred for roosting and nesting.

Migrating bald eagles demonstrate the following seasonal habitat preferences:

  • Wintering Grounds: Typically near unfrozen water sources with abundant fish or waterfowl.
  • Stopover Sites: Areas rich in food and shelter that allow eagles to rest during long migrations.
  • Breeding Sites: Locations with old-growth trees or cliffs for nest building, often near water.

The adaptability of bald eagles to various habitats during migration enhances their survival. They are known to utilize urban and suburban environments when natural habitats are scarce, often scavenging on carrion or human waste.

Comparison of Migratory Behavior by Region

Migration tendencies vary widely across the bald eagle’s range. The following table summarizes typical migration patterns based on geographic location:

Region Migration Behavior Distance Traveled Primary Winter Habitat
Alaska and Northern Canada Full migration southward Up to 1,500 miles Coastal estuaries, unfrozen rivers
Midwestern United States Partial migration; some resident 100-500 miles Large lakes, river valleys
Southeastern United States Mostly resident; minimal migration Less than 100 miles Coastal wetlands, reservoirs
Pacific Northwest Partial migration; resident populations Varies widely Estuaries, forested river corridors

Tracking and Research Methods on Bald Eagle Migration

Modern research techniques have greatly enhanced understanding of bald eagle migration. Scientists employ several methods to monitor movements and study migratory behavior:

  • Satellite Telemetry: Attaching GPS transmitters to track real-time migration routes and distances.
  • Banding and Tagging: Marking birds with identification bands to record sightings and migration timing.
  • Radar Monitoring: Using radar to detect large-scale migration events.
  • Observation Stations: Monitoring migration flyways at known bottlenecks or stopover sites.

These methods have revealed detailed insights such as migration timing, individual variation in routes, and the influence of environmental factors on movement patterns. Data collected through tracking also inform conservation strategies by identifying critical habitats and potential threats along migratory corridors.

Factors Affecting Bald Eagle Migration Decisions

Several ecological and physiological factors influence whether an individual bald eagle migrates or remains resident in its habitat:

  • Age and Experience: Juvenile and subadult bald eagles are more likely to migrate as they seek optimal foraging grounds and territories.
  • Breeding Status: Breeding adults tend to be more sedentary during nesting season to protect nests and offspring.
  • Food Resource Stability: Availability of fish and carrion reduces the need for long-distance travel.
  • Habitat Suitability: Access to open water and suitable roosting sites affects site fidelity and migration tendencies.
  • Weather Extremes: Sudden cold snaps or storms can trigger temporary movements.

How Bald Eagles Navigate During Migration

Bald eagles employ a combination of innate and learned navigational strategies during migration. Their methods include:

  • Solar and Magnetic Cues: Like many birds, eagles can sense the Earth’s magnetic field and use the sun’s position for orientation.
  • Visual Landmarks: Rivers, coastlines, mountain ranges, and human-made structures provide visual guides.
  • Thermal Currents and Wind Patterns: Bald eagles utilize thermals (rising columns of warm air) to soar and conserve energy over long distances.

These abilities enable eagles to travel efficiently between seasonal habitats, sometimes covering hundreds of miles in a single day.

Frequently Asked Questions (FAQs)

Does a bald eagle migrate seasonally?
Yes, many bald eagles migrate seasonally, especially those breeding in northern regions, moving southward to find open water and food during winter.

Do all bald eagles migrate?
No, not all bald eagles migrate. Those living in milder climates or near year-round food sources often remain in the same area throughout the year.

What factors influence bald eagle migration?
Migration depends on food availability, weather conditions, and geographic location. Bald eagles typically migrate to avoid frozen water bodies that limit access to fish.

How far do bald eagles migrate?
Bald eagle migration distances vary widely, ranging from short local movements to several hundred miles, depending on the individual and environmental conditions.

When do bald eagles usually begin migration?
Bald eagles generally start migrating in late fall as temperatures drop and food becomes scarce, returning to breeding grounds in early spring.

Do juvenile bald eagles migrate differently than adults?
Yes, juvenile bald eagles often migrate later and may travel farther than adults, as they explore new territories before establishing permanent ranges.
